版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)
文檔簡介
數(shù)據(jù)庫原理與應(yīng)用期末復(fù)習(xí)第1章緒論
理解數(shù)據(jù)、數(shù)據(jù)庫、DBMS、DBS的概念DBMS的主要功能了解數(shù)據(jù)管理技術(shù)發(fā)展的三個階段及特點數(shù)據(jù)庫系統(tǒng)的特點數(shù)據(jù)模型的組成要素理解實體和三類聯(lián)系,E-R圖的繪制理解層次、網(wǎng)狀、關(guān)系模型的表示及其特點理解數(shù)據(jù)庫系統(tǒng)結(jié)構(gòu)的三級模式和兩級映像第2章關(guān)系數(shù)據(jù)庫標準語言SQL
SQL的概念和特點建表,刪除表,理解索引的適用數(shù)據(jù)查詢SELECT語句的使用(包括各個子句,連接和子查詢)數(shù)據(jù)的增insert、刪delete、改update理解視圖的概念特點、視圖的建立和操作第3章關(guān)系數(shù)據(jù)庫關(guān)系的相關(guān)概念(域、笛卡爾積、關(guān)系、主碼、候選碼、主屬性、非主屬性、全碼等)關(guān)系操作,基本關(guān)系操作、關(guān)系操作的特點理解關(guān)系的三類完整性約束關(guān)系代數(shù)的運算(選擇、投影、連接、除)第4章數(shù)據(jù)庫安全性
了解數(shù)據(jù)庫安全性控制的相關(guān)技術(shù)了解存取控制的內(nèi)容和方法自主存取控制方法的操作理解用戶、角色、權(quán)限等概念第5章數(shù)據(jù)庫完整性
理解數(shù)據(jù)庫完整性的概念和常用機制掌握三類完整性約束的實現(xiàn)理解觸發(fā)器的概念、作用和實現(xiàn)
第6章關(guān)系數(shù)據(jù)理論
1NF的要求和存在問題理解非平凡/平凡的函數(shù)依賴,部分函數(shù)依賴,多值依賴理解2NF,3NF,BCNF,4NF的要求,并能按要求進行模式分解理解數(shù)據(jù)庫設(shè)計的基本步驟及各階段的任務(wù)繪制E-R圖及合并分E-R圖掌握邏輯結(jié)構(gòu)設(shè)計(E-R圖向關(guān)系模型的轉(zhuǎn)換)索引及聚簇索引的使用特點第7章數(shù)據(jù)庫設(shè)計
第9章數(shù)據(jù)庫恢復(fù)技術(shù)
理解事務(wù)的概念和特性了解四類故障的概念恢復(fù)機制的兩個關(guān)鍵問題理解建立冗余數(shù)據(jù)的常用方式了解事務(wù)故障、系統(tǒng)故障、介質(zhì)故障的恢復(fù)方式第10章并發(fā)控制
理解串行執(zhí)行和并發(fā)執(zhí)行的概念理解并發(fā)控制帶來的不一致性問題兩類封鎖類型及其操作實現(xiàn)理解死鎖、活鎖的概念,死鎖的診斷和排除方法理解并發(fā)調(diào)度的可串行化/非串行化調(diào)度/沖突可串行化調(diào)度理解兩段鎖協(xié)議并使用理解封鎖的粒度了解意向鎖的概念試卷格式和題型分布一、填空題(每空1分,共20分)
基本概念(各章)二、判斷題(正確標√,錯誤標×,每題1分,共10分)
基本概念(各章)三、單項選擇題(每題2分,共30分)
基本概念(各章)四、設(shè)計題(每題6分,共24分)
SQL語句、關(guān)系代數(shù)操作、視圖設(shè)計、關(guān)系規(guī)范化處理五、應(yīng)用題(第1題8分,第2題8分,共16分)
E-R圖設(shè)計、并發(fā)控制典型試題分析(設(shè)計題)
1.有如下三個關(guān)系模式:S(SNO,SNAME,AGE,SEX)屬性含義是學(xué)號、姓名、年齡、性別;SC(SNO,CNO,GRADE)屬性含義分別是學(xué)號、課程號、成績;C(CNO,CNAME)屬性含義分別是課程號、課程名。用SQL語言完成下列操作:(1)求選修C4(課程號)的學(xué)生的平均年齡;(2)刪除所有選修C1(課程號)課程的選課記錄;解答:(1)SELECTAVG(AGE)FROMSWHERESNOIN(SELECTSNOFROMSCWHERECNO=’C4’)
或SELECTAVG(AGE)FROMS,SCWHERES.SNO=SC.SNOANDCNO=’C4’(2)DELETEFROMSCWHERECNO=’C1’典型試題分析(設(shè)計題)2.有如下四個關(guān)系模式:學(xué)生:S(SNO,SN,AGE,SEX)屬性是學(xué)號、姓名、年齡、性別;課程:C(CNO,CN,PCNO)屬性是課程號、課程名、先修課課程號;教師:T(ENO,EN,DEPT)屬性是教師號、教師名、所屬系;成績:SC(SNO,CNO,ENO,G)屬性是學(xué)號、課程號、教師號、成績。試用關(guān)系代數(shù)完成下列操作:(1)求選修所有課程的學(xué)生的學(xué)號;(2)查詢選修了《電子商務(wù)》課程的學(xué)生的學(xué)號和姓名;解答:(1)
或者
(2)典型試題分析(設(shè)計題)3.設(shè)有如下關(guān)系學(xué)生:Student(Sno,Sname,Sex,Sage,Sdept)
屬性含義分別為學(xué)號、姓名、性別、年齡、系;課程:Course(Cno,Cname,Cpno,Ccredit)
屬性含義分別為課程號、課程名、先修課程號、學(xué)分;選修:SC(Sno,Cno,Grade)
屬性含義分別為學(xué)號、課程號、成績。試用SQL語言完成下列操作。(1)在SC表中插入一條選課記錄:學(xué)號:03004,課程號:3,成績:88;(2)建立一個視圖S_G,包括學(xué)生的學(xué)號,選課門數(shù),平均成績;解答:(1)
INSERTINTOSCVALUES(‘03004’,‘3’,88)(2)
CREATEVIEWS_G(Sno,C,A)
ASSELECTSNO,COUNT(*),AVG(GRADE)FROMSCGROUPBYSNO典型試題分析(設(shè)計題)4.設(shè)有關(guān)系模式:TEACHER(教師編號,教師姓名,電話,所在部門,借閱圖書編號,書名,借書日期,還書日期,備注)試完成以下分析:(1)教師編號是候選碼嗎?說明理由。(2)該關(guān)系模式是否存在部分函數(shù)依賴?如果存在,請寫出至少兩個?解答:(1)教師編號不是候選碼。候選碼為(教師編號,借閱圖書編號,借書日期),因為教師編號不能惟一標識一個記錄。(2)存在部分函數(shù)依賴;教師姓名,電話,所在部門對候選碼是部分函數(shù)依賴,因為教師姓名,電話,所在部門只完全函數(shù)依賴于教師編號;書名對碼是部分函數(shù)依賴,因為它完全函數(shù)依賴于借閱圖書編號。典型試題分析(應(yīng)用題)1、學(xué)生包括學(xué)號,姓名,性別,年齡等基本信息;課程包括課程編號,課程名等;教師包括教師代號,姓名,性別,職稱等;上述實體存在如下聯(lián)系:一個學(xué)生可以選修多門課程,一門課程可為多個學(xué)生選修;一個教師可講授多門課程,一門課程由一個教師講授;試完成以下問題:(1)畫出這個數(shù)據(jù)庫的E-R圖。(2)將E-R模型轉(zhuǎn)化為適當(dāng)?shù)年P(guān)系模型,并給出候選關(guān)鍵字。解答:(1)E-R圖:(2)關(guān)系模式學(xué)生(學(xué)號,姓名,性別,年齡)課程(課程號,課程名,教師號)教師(教師號,姓名,性別,職稱)選修(學(xué)號,課程號,成績)典型試題分析(應(yīng)用題)2、考慮下列兩個事務(wù):T1:READ(A)T2:READ(B)READ(B)READ(A)IFA=0THENB:=B+1IFB=0THENA:=A+1;WRITE(B)WRITE(A)設(shè)數(shù)據(jù)庫的一致性要求是A=0orB=0,A、B的初值為0。(1)寫出這兩個事務(wù)并發(fā)執(zhí)行所有可能的正確結(jié)果;(2)寫一個遵守兩段鎖協(xié)議且不發(fā)生死鎖的并發(fā)調(diào)度策略;(3)寫一個遵守兩段鎖協(xié)議發(fā)生死鎖的并發(fā)調(diào)度策略。解答:(1)兩個事務(wù)并發(fā)調(diào)度的正確結(jié)果有兩種
T1-T2:執(zhí)行結(jié)果B=1,A=0T2-T1:執(zhí)行結(jié)果A=1,B=0解答:(2)
T1T2SLOCK(A)READ(A=0)SLOCK(B)READ(B=0)XLOCK(B)SLOCK(B)B=B+1等待WRITE(B=1)等待UNLOCK(A)等待UNLOCK(B)等待UNLOCK(B)等待REA
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 2024年黑龍江省《消防員資格證之一級防火考試》必刷500題標準卷
- 2024年高考生物必修全部和選修1基礎(chǔ)知識清單(以問題串形式呈現(xiàn))含答案
- 單位管理制度集粹匯編【人事管理】十篇
- 單位管理制度范例合集【人員管理】十篇
- 藝術(shù)概論試題庫
- 第5單元 國防建設(shè)與外交成就(B卷·能力提升練)(解析版)
- 某鋼結(jié)構(gòu)棧橋及轉(zhuǎn)換房制安工程招標文件
- 《語文上冊》課件
- 稅收優(yōu)惠政策對貧困地區(qū)發(fā)展影響評估-洞察分析
- 語義演變與認知機制-洞察分析
- 水利水電工程安全管理制度例文(三篇)
- 2025四川宜賓市南溪區(qū)屬國企業(yè)招聘融資人員6人管理單位筆試遴選500模擬題附帶答案詳解
- DB45T 2048-2019 微型消防站建設(shè)管理規(guī)范
- SCTP大云云計算PT2題庫【深信服】認證考試題庫及答案
- 外研版(2024新版)七年級上冊英語期末質(zhì)量監(jiān)測試卷 3套(含答案)
- 《測土配方施肥》課件
- 人教版2024-2025學(xué)年第一學(xué)期八年級物理期末綜合復(fù)習(xí)練習(xí)卷(含答案)
- 職業(yè)健康檢查管理制度
- 電梯維保管理體系手冊
- 2024年國家電網(wǎng)招聘之通信類題庫及參考答案(考試直接用)
- 第12課《詞四首》課件+2023-2024學(xué)年統(tǒng)編版語文九年級下冊
評論
0/150
提交評論